If trouble occurs

Symptom

Check item

Cause/Solutions

The power is not
turned on.

• Is the plug of the AC

adaptor connected correctly?

c Connect the AC adaptor correctly

(page 13).

• Is the built-in battery pack

out of charge?

Some images are
not displayed.

• Are the images displayed in

the index view?

• Does the mark displayed

below appear in the index
view?

c If the image is displayed in the index view

but cannot be displayed as single image,
the image file may be damaged even
though its thumbnail preview data is fine.

c If a mark is displayed, the thumbnail data

or image itself cannot be opened.

c A file that is not compatible with DCF

may not be displayed with the photo
frame, even if it can be displayed with a
computer.

• Are there more than 4,999

images in the internal
memory, external memory
or memory card?

c The photo frame can play, save, delete, or

otherwise handle up to 4,999 image files.

• Did you rename the file with

a computer or other device?

c If you named or renamed the file on your

computer and the file name includes
characters other than alphanumeric
characters, the image may not be able to
be displayed on the photo frame.

• Is there a folder with more

than 8 levels in its hierarchy
on the memory card or in the
external device?

c The photo frame cannot display images

saved in a folder that is more than 8 levels
deep.

A video file is not
played.

• Does the mark displayed

below appear in the index or
single view display?

c If the mark shown on the left is displayed,

the video file may not supported by the
photo frame. For video files that cannot be
played, see “Playing a video file”
(page 19).

Fast forward/
backward
playback is not
available.

c Fast forward/backward playback of some

video files may not be available with the
photo frame.
